"THE WEST COAST SETTLEMENT RESERVES ACT, 1892."
NOTICE to NATIVE OWNERS and LESSEE of a MEETING to be held at the COURT-HOUSE, MANAIA, at 2 o'clock p.m. on THURSDAY, the 5th JULY, 1894, to fix the RENT for a NEW LEASE to LEONARD MAXWELL TAUNTON of Sections 35, 36, and 37, Block VII., WAIMATE, containing 199 acres (more or less), being the Land comprised in Memorandum of Lease registered No. 714.
TO Manaia Hukunui and the other Native owners of all that piece of land situate in the Waimate Survey District, being Sections 35, 36, and 37, Block VII., and containing by admeasurement 199 acres (more or less), being the land comprised in memorandum of lease, registered No. 714, to Leonard Maxwell Taunton, of Stratford, farmer.
Whereas the above-named Leonard Maxwell Taunton has given notice to me, under the provisions of section 8 of "The West Coast Settlement Reserves Act, 1892," that he desires to obtain under that section a new lease of the land above described; and I consider his application ought to be given effect to: Now, therefore, I do hereby appoint a meeting to take place between the said Leonard Maxwell Taunton and all the Native owners of the above-described land, for the purpose of fixing the rent to be paid for the said land for the first twenty-one years of the new lease; and I fix the Courthouse, Manaia, as the place where, and Thursday, the 5th day of July, 1894, at 2 o'clock in the afternoon, as the time when, such meeting shall take place.
